The Oathguard series primarily follows the life of Myunh Yala, an Oathguard who is accused of subversive activity in her home country of Sinolor. Knowing she is indeed partially culpable, and fearing the punishment she faces if convicted, Myunh reluctantly flees to the neighboring Thassadia at the behest of Alrion Yala, her mysterious cousin.

Four years later, the machinations of ambitious men in every nation have caused the continent’s political climate to shift drastically for the worse, and Myunh’s connection to Alrion—perhaps the most ambitious man of all—will take her back to Sinolor, the stage for the upcoming conflict. There, she will confront her past choices, reunite with old friends and foes alike, and find herself becoming more than just a witness to history in the making as she fights to repel a relentless invasion.

While she is initially more or less only along for the ride thanks to her sibling-like relationship with Alrion, various meetings, happenings, and revelations during the course of the series will lead Myunh to take a more active role as a leader.

But whether she finds herself to be a hero by the story’s end is another matter entirely.

*


This Prologue takes place 23 years before Myunh’s return to her homeland, during the height of what would later be called the Fortnight War.

While skirmishes rage elsewhere, a veteran Oathguard of Sinolor has embarked on a mission to apprehend several “Compremised” Oathguards who appear to be defecting to the enemy nation, Heiml, via the treacherous Banda mountain range that forms a natural border between the countries.

Sinolor’s military leadership, preoccupied with the main war effort, issues this otherwise-critical mission with indifference. However, it is of great personal importance to one they have dispatched to complete it—for the most powerful of the targets she relentlessly pursues is also her husband, and she has resolved to end his life if he really is a traitor, in order to protect their daughter. More than anything, though, she seeks the truth.

She is Ordinator Gela Yala. The fugitive is former Ordinator Bocheul Yala. Their daughter Myunh is yet an infant, but the events that follow her parents’ confrontation at Banda Pass will shape the course of her life, among many others’.

The year is 781 S.A., and the continent quietly teeters on the end of an era.

Designed in RM2k3, Oathguard's Prologue features:
* A traditional turn-based battle system that uses a unique "Demon Transformation" system similar to those in the Shadow Hearts or Persona series
* Ability to equip skills on the fly in battle in order to combat enemies of a certain type more effectively
* Various types of weapons, graphs, and coins available to equip that grant different types of basic attacks in battle, or passive abilities
* Customizaiton of Gela's stats to fit the player's gameplay stye by using "Remnants" gained from leveling up
* Several unique gameplay touches, such as the "Magis Eye", which keeps the player aware of important events or battles up ahead (as a handy reminder to save his/her game); and the "Converse" option, which updates the player on the current situation while also adding to the game's narrative
